Understanding Apartment Financing in Frankston
Buying a home in the form of an apartment has become increasingly popular among Frankston residents. Whether you're a first-time buyer or looking to downsize, understanding the specific requirements for apartment financing can help you make informed decisions about your property purchase.
When applying for a home loan for an apartment, lenders assess several factors differently compared to traditional house purchases. The loan to value ratio (LVR) often plays a crucial role, with many lenders requiring a lower LVR for apartment purchases. This means you may need a larger deposit, typically ranging from 10% to 20% of the property value.
Key Factors Affecting Your Apartment Home Loan
Several elements influence your home loan application when purchasing an apartment:
• Building specifications: Lenders evaluate the apartment complex's construction materials, particularly concrete versus timber frame construction
• Floor level: Some lenders have restrictions on high-rise apartments above certain floors
• Building size: The total number of units in the complex can affect lending criteria
• Strata management: Well-managed body corporate arrangements are viewed favourably by lenders
Calculating Home Loan Repayments for Apartments
When calculating home loan repayments, consider both your mortgage payments and ongoing strata fees. These additional costs impact your borrowing capacity and should be factored into your financial situation assessment. Lenders will evaluate your ability to service both the loan amount and these additional expenses.
Your borrowing capacity depends on various factors including your income, existing debts, and the property's characteristics. Banks and lenders across Australia have different appetite levels for apartment lending, which is where professional guidance becomes valuable.

Interest Rate Options for Apartment Purchases
Apartment buyers can access both variable interest rate and fixed interest rate options. Each has distinct advantages:
Variable Home Loan Rates:
• Potential interest rate discounts
• Offset account facilities
• Flexibility to make additional repayments
• Rate movements reflect market conditions
Fixed Interest Rate Home Loans:
• Predictable repayments for the fixed period
• Protection against interest rate increases
• Budgeting certainty
• Various term lengths available
The Application Process for Apartment Loans
The home loan application process for apartments involves several steps. Getting pre-approved provides clarity on your borrowing capacity before you start property hunting. Home loan pre-approval demonstrates to vendors that you're a serious buyer with confirmed financing capacity.
During the application process, you'll need to provide bank statements, income documentation, and details about the specific apartment you're purchasing. The streamlined application process varies between lenders, with some offering more efficient systems than others.
Managing Additional Costs
Apartment purchases involve several additional costs beyond the purchase price:
- Stamp duty: Varies by state and property value
- Lenders mortgage insurance (LMI): Required if borrowing above 80% LVR
- Building and pest inspections: Essential for apartment purchases
- Legal fees: Conveyancing and contract review
- Strata reports: Understanding body corporate finances

Building Home Equity Through Apartment Ownership
Apartment ownership allows you to build home equity over time through principal repayments and potential capital growth. This equity can be utilised for future property investments or accessing additional finance for renovations or other purposes.
